Phone won't turn on
Your phone might not to turn on after repeatedly pressing the turn on button. Some possible explanations are detailed below.
Drained/bad battery
If your phone won't turn on and the battery does not hold a charge, then the battery is dead and needs to be replaced.
Bad display
It is possible that it appears nothing is happening because the display is bad. The screen might have taken in water or it might be cracked. If the display is faulty, it must be replaced. Here is a link to replacing the LCD screen. Motorola Defy LCD Replacement
Faulty motherboard
If all of the other has been checked, the problem most likely lies in the motherboard and must be replaced. If your phone has been in contact with water it means that your motherboard might be damaged. Here is a link to replacing the motherboard. Motorola Defy Motherboard Replacement
Phone not producing sound
You have tried to turn the volume up and down, but cannot hear anything.
Volume is muted
Before tearing the phone apart, check to see that the volume on the phone has not been muted.
Speaker is broken
If you have checked the phone to make sure the volume is not muted and there is still no sound, then the speaker may be broken and must be replaced. Here is a link to replacing the speaker. Motorola Defy Earpiece Speaker Replacement
Phone calls are not connecting
You know a friend is calling you but you are unable to establish a connection.
Poor signal
If calls are not connecting or being dropped, this may be due to being in a poor area for cell phone reception or signal. Often times, one can check the cell phone providers website and see a map of good and bad cell phone reception areas.
Antenna is broken
If, after checking the cell phone services map for good and bad reception areas and the signal and phone calls are still not connecting properly, then the antenna may be broken, and must be replaced. Here is a link to replacing the antenna. Motorola Defy Antenna Replacement
Phones camera does not work
You have tried to use the camera on your phone, but the camera does not seem to be working right.
The display is broken
Before taking apart the phone, make sure that the phones screen is working properly. If you cannot do or see anything on the screen, then the LCD screen is broken and must be replaced.
Broken camera module
If you have checked the above for any errors with the LCD screen, and everything else seems to be working properly with the phone, then it is most likely the camera module itself is broken and must be replaced. Here is a guide to replacing the camera module. Motorola Defy Rear Facing Camera Replacement
